Ver Mensaje Individual
  #1 (permalink)  
Antiguo 24/01/2013, 15:01
obrian1180
 
Fecha de Ingreso: enero-2013
Mensajes: 1
Antigüedad: 11 años, 3 meses
Puntos: 0
Pregunta Empezando en Java

Hola buenas tardes no sé si acá es donde puedo coloca este tipo de temas, pido disculpas de ante mano si no es acá donde va.

Buenos verán estoy nuevo en la programación, tanto así que mi duda trata sobre la sentencia While. Para no dar muchas vueltas este es el codigo;

Quiero que al terminar el programa me pregunte otra vez si quiero hacer otra operación y me de vuelva al menú principal, de lo contrario. Salir. Gracias de verdad, recién estoy comenzando.


CODIGO:
import java.util.Scanner;

public class Sumadora {

public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);


//MENÚ DE OPCIONES...

System.out.println("Menú de opciones, elija una opción");
System.out.println("Opción 1 = Sumará dos números");
System.out.println("Opción 2 = Restará dos números");
System.out.println("opcion 3 = multiplicara dos numero");
System.out.println("opcion 4 = dividira dos numeros");
System.out.println("opcion 5 = Salir");

System.out.println();
System.out.print("Ingrese la opción de su preferenc1ia... ");

int opcion = scanner.nextInt();

if (opcion==1){
System.out.println("Usted escogió sumar");}
if (opcion==2){
System.out.println("Usted escogio restar");}
if (opcion==3){
System.out.println("Usted escogio multiplicar");}
if (opcion==4){
System.out.println("Usted escogio dividir");}
if (opcion==5){
System.out.println("Usted escogio salir, Adios");}


else{
//PEDIRÁ LOS NÚMEROS A PARA HACER LAS RESPECTIVAS OPERACIONES.
System.out.print("Ingrese el primer número:");
int numero1 = scanner.nextInt();
System.out.print("Ingrese el segundo número:");
int numero2 = scanner.nextInt();
int resultado = 0 ;
if (opcion==1){
resultado = (numero1)+(numero2);}
if (opcion==2){
resultado = (numero1)-(numero2);}
if (opcion==3){
resultado = (numero1)*(numero2);}
if (opcion==4){
resultado = (numero1)/(numero2);}


System.out.print("El resultado es: ");
System.out.println(resultado);
System.out.println("Si desea hacer otra operacion pulse s de lo contrario n: ");


}

}
}

Donde podría ir el while?